The project will be implemented at Holcim's Dotternhausen cement plant in Germany, as announced by Orcan Energy. This new facility will harness previously unused waste heat from the plant's exhaust gases, extracting approximately 10 MW of thermal energy through a heat exchanger positioned about 70 meters high.
